Summary
We are seeking a skilled and highly motivated HVAC Technician to support the operation and maintenance of HVAC and facility mechanical systems within a fast-paced manufacturing environment. The successful candidate will play a critical role in maintaining production uptime by ensuring HVAC, compressed air, ventilation, and related building systems operate safely, efficiently, and reliably.
The ideal candidate possesses strong troubleshooting abilities, hands-on mechanical and electrical experience, and a proactive approach to preventive and predictive maintenance. This position requires the ability to respond quickly to equipment issues, minimize downtime, and support continuous improvement initiatives within the manufacturing facility.
Description
- Maintain, troubleshoot, repair, and optimize HVAC and facility mechanical systems to support uninterrupted manufacturing operations;
- Perform pre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ance on HVAC equipment, including air handlers, RTUs, chillers, pumps, motors, VFDs, ventilation systems, and associated controls;
- Respond rapidly to equipment failures and production-related issues to minimize downtime and maintain operational efficiency;
- Monitor system performance and identify opportunities to improve reliability, energy efficiency, and equipment life cycle;
- Conduct daily inspections of HVAC and supporting facility equipment;
- Diagnose mechanical, electrical, and control system failures and implement effective corrective actions;
- Support manufacturing operations by maintaining appropriate temperature, humidity, ventilation, and air quality conditions;
- Utilize computerized maintenance management systems (CMMS) to document maintenance activities, work orders, inspections, and repairs;
- Collaborate with production, engineering, and maintenance teams to prioritize work and support production schedules;
- Participate in root cause analysis investigations and continuous improvement initiatives;
- Ensure compliance with safety policies, environmental requirements, and regulatory standards;
- Identify unsafe conditions and recommend corrective actions to management;
- Assist with equipment installations, upgrades, and commissioning projects;
- Participate in emergency response and on-call support as required.
Requirements
- Authorized to work in the US;
- Qualified to pass a security screening and medical examination;
- High School Diploma or equivalent;
- Journeyman HVAC/R License or equivalent trade certification preferred;
- Minimum 5 years of HVAC maintenance experience in an industrial or manufacturing environment;
- Mechanical and electrical troubleshooting experience;
- Valid Driver''s License;
- EPA Refrigeration Certification (where required);
- Working knowledge of Building Automation Systems (BAS) and/or Building Management Systems (BMS);
- Experience using CMMS software for maintenance planning and documentation;
- Ability to read and interpret technical drawings, equipment manuals, schematics, and wiring diagrams;
- Strong understanding of industrial HVAC systems, ventilation systems, motors, pumps, and controls;
- Experience with manufacturing equipment support, compressed air systems, or industrial utilities is considered an asset;
- Ability to work overtime, rotating shifts, and respond to emergency situations when required.
